NewTV Adding 2 new HD Channels with RCN

Now, all of Newton's community programming will be in high definition

RCN Boston and NewTV announced today that they have launched two new high definition (HD) channels for community television programming. These are the second and third HD channels for NewTV which launched its first channel, #(613,) in 2013, the most HD channels for any community television network in Massachusetts on the RCN system.

“NewTV viewers will now have the ultimate experience in watching their community-originated programming with the addition of the two new HD channels,” said Bob Kelly, Executive Director of NewTV. “NewTV viewers will have their favorite community programs all in high definition. RCN is a great community partner since launching the first HD channel two years ago and continues with supporting NewTV’s expansion to a total of three HD channels.”

The additional HD channels, #(614) and #(629) will be dedicated to government and educational programming. The NewTVg Government Channel, #(614) features municipal meetings such as City Council and School Committee, in addition to original shows including “Beyond the Badge” and “Books and Beyond”. The NewTVe Education Channel, #(629) features programming for students, teachers and administrators, and also includes the Emmy® Award-winning series, “The Folklorist.” The Community Channel, NewTVc #(613,) will continue to offer quality programming created by and for the community.

“RCN has a sharp focus on bringing the best technology to our customers and our partnership with NewTV, bringing additional HD channels to its viewers, matches that,” said Jeff Carlson, VP and General Manager of RCN Boston. “NewTV is a vital part of the Newton community fabric and reflects the creativity and uniqueness of its residents.”

NewTV provides hundreds of programs created for local, regional and national audiences. Shows range from those on public affairs, history, cooking, arts and culture, to high school sports and live streaming of public meetings. NewTV is a member of MassAccess which serves and supports the needs of Massachusetts community media centers who provide for public, educational, and governmental access services to Massachusetts cities and towns.

About NewTV

NewTV is Newton’s Emmy® Award-winning, state-of-the-art HD media center, specializing in television production, training and content distribution. NewTV’s three cable channels (Community, Education and Government) broadcast locally relevant programming to the diverse Newton community and provide a platform for members to express their vision. www.newtv.org
